Location:
http://www.deerfields.com <http://www.deerfields.com/> - One of the most
beautiful venues in North America! Deerfield's is an exquisite 940-acre
family-owned wilderness retreat complete with incredible ponds, creeks,
apple orchards, forests, wildlife and hiking trails. Please respect the land
and LEAVE NO TRACE! This is a Rain or Shine event with rustic camping
accommodations - bring EVERYTHING you'll need to survive..there is no
re-entry. Arrive Friday or Sat. before midnight, gates will be closed at
midnight. If you are expected to arrive late, please prearrange with us so
that we may accommodate your plans.
